The California Health Collaborative is recruiting one full-time Community Engagement Coordinator for the Smoke Free High Country Program. This Program takes place in Lassen, Plumas, and Siskiyou counties to reduce tobacco related disparities and advance momentum for a tobacco free California. The CEC will coordinate program activities, oversee general communications, gauge political temperature for local policy adoption, and support community norm change around tobacco use and control.

Under general supervision of the Project Director, the Community Engagement Coordinator supports the planning, implementation and evaluation activities of the Smoke Free High Country Project.
